Commit Graph

18 Commits

Author SHA1 Message Date
Dane Everitt
c90fcea519 Add basic file listing functionality 2019-07-27 20:23:51 -07:00
Dane Everitt
48c39abfcb Add database password rotation to view 2019-07-27 15:17:50 -07:00
Dane Everitt
f6ee885f26 Support for viewing database passwords 2019-07-16 22:29:00 -07:00
Dane Everitt
d081f328ab Support deleting existing databases 2019-07-16 22:15:14 -07:00
Dane Everitt
1f763dc155 Finish support for creating databases in the UI 2019-07-16 21:43:11 -07:00
Dane Everitt
61dc86421d Add basic modal support 2019-07-09 22:41:09 -07:00
Dane Everitt
bb3486f559 More style cleanup for database listing 2019-07-09 22:06:42 -07:00
Dane Everitt
e3db564175 Add basic support for listing a server's databases 2019-07-09 22:00:29 -07:00
Dane Everitt
986285402f Switch to a context store for server stuff to better support things in the future 2019-07-09 21:25:57 -07:00
Dane Everitt
16e6f3f45f Attempting to solve a weird console loading issue by making into class component; doesn't fix but like the class better for this.
Loading the console, switching to file manager, and then switching back is needed to load the data the first time. After that every 2nd load of the console will load the data (and even send the data to the websocket as the daemon is reporting.)
2019-06-29 18:28:23 -07:00
Dane Everitt
6b42296865 Correctly listen for unmount event 2019-06-29 17:48:35 -07:00
Dane Everitt
48f449e6d7 Send the logs on mount 2019-06-29 17:40:50 -07:00
Dane Everitt
e0838c895a First pass at connecting to console and rendering the output from the server. 2019-06-29 17:18:17 -07:00
Dane Everitt
6db9f65e0f Hide spinner when connected to websocket 2019-06-29 16:59:50 -07:00
Dane Everitt
c8d89e0964 Correctly handle socket state in the app and make it possible to listen for events 2019-06-29 16:57:11 -07:00
Dane Everitt
f0ca8bc3a3 Handle connecting to websocket instance
Very beta code for handling sockets
2019-06-29 16:14:32 -07:00
Dane Everitt
109bed4f7d Add basic navigation bar to server view 2019-06-28 22:49:08 -07:00
Dane Everitt
8ac8a370f8 Fix some issues with navigating in the router and bad animations 2019-06-28 22:17:29 -07:00